§ 34-21-2 — Definition of terms.

South Dakota·Title 34 PUBLIC HEALTH AND SAFETY·Ch. 34 RADIATION AND URANIUM RESOURCES EXPOSURE CONTROL

Terms used in this chapter mean:

(1)By - product material, any radioactive material (except special nuclear material) yielded in or made radioactive by exposure to the radiation incident to the process of producing or utilizing special nuclear material;
(2)General license, a license effective pursuant to regulations promulgated by the agency, without the filing of any application, to transfer, acquire, own, possess, or use quantities of, or devices or equipment utilizing by - product, source, special nuclear materials, or other radioactive material occurring naturally or produced artificially;
(3)Nuclear energy, all forms of energy released in the course of nuclear fission or nuclear transformation;
